RAD PDF 3.15 Released

Red Software is excited to announce version 3.15 of RAD PDF, the ASP.NET (and ASP.NET Core) component for PDF viewing, editing, form filling, signing and more! With this update, client side rendering now better matches server rendering when using unsupported features, and server side rendering has also been improved, particularly when rendering "striped" images.

Additionally, data URLs can now be used to set images or append files, allowing for easier integration with custom image source integrations.

Lite Documents can now also be appended to another Lite Document instance, allowing for more flexible document merging.

RAD PDF 3.14 Released

Red Software is proud to announce version 3.14 of the most full featured ASP.NET / ASP.NET Core web control for viewing, form filling, and editing PDF files, RAD PDF. This update includes a number of improvements including:

  • ASP.NET Core improvements - use RAD PDF without Synchronous IO
  • GetPaths() method added to PdfSignatureShape - retrieve drawn signatures as paths
  • Render At Client improvements - JS errors in rendering falls back to server and Range support
  • Undo support - users can now undo PDF changes in the GUI

Additionally, this new version includes file upload improvements (file type filters) and several bug fixes.

RAD PDF 3.13.5 Update

Today, Red Software releases an update to RAD PDF, the ASP.NET / ASP.NET Core GUI for PDF files and forms. Version 3.13.5 includes updates for the latest iOS changes.

We improved the user interface when using Safari on iOS while browsing with "Request Desktop Website" turned "On", the current default on iPad. RAD PDF now also supports Bluetooth mice / pointing devices on iOS, a new feature in iOS 13.4. Some mobile pinch and zoom improvements have been made, allowing for a better experience in mobile browsers.

This version also fixes a bug cropping text in a non-wrapping PdfTextShape, in some cases while using Safari on iOS.

RAD PDF 3.13 Released

Red Software is proud to announce version 3.13 of RAD PDF, the ASP.NET (and ASP.NET Core) PDF reader, editor, form filler, and more. Implementations of our PDF web control can now export and import objects added by the user, allowing integrations more flexibility when using RAD PDF. Additionally, this update includes rendering improvements both to the client and server side code base along with improving the display of embedded JPEG 2000 images.

This version also includes a new advanced option to display a "Next Field" button which can be enabled (or enabled just for iOS) allowing for smoother tabbing between fields. If interested, please contact Red Software for more information about this feature.

RAD PDF 3.12 Released

Red Software is excited to announce RAD PDF 3.12, its newest ASP.NET (and ASP.NET Core) PDF web control / GUI (graphical user interface). The PDF reader, editor, form filler, and signature tools can now use client rendering (RenderAtClient) to print and search documents, allowing for all RAD PDF resources to be rendered client-side in modern browsers (and potentially without needing the RAD PDF System Service).

Radio button improvements and bug fixes are also implemented in this latest version. Some radio fields were incorrectly identified as checkbox fields and the NoToggleToOff flag is no longer assumed to always be set for radio fields.

This update also features a number of bug fixes including touch screen improvements and a work around for printing in Edge.

Additionally, Production Licenses have been renamed Server Licenses. Functionally, the licenses are the same, but we believe better communicates RAD PDF's licensing policies. If you have any questions, please contact Red Software.
